FUNDS AVAILABILITY POLICY DISCLOSURE. This disclosure describes your ability to withdraw funds at Texas Tech Federal Credit Union. It only applies to the availability of funds in transaction accounts. The credit union reserves the right to delay the availability of funds deposited to accounts that are not transaction accounts for periods longer than those disclosed in this policy. Please ask us if you have a question about which accounts are affected by this policy. General Policy Our policy is to make funds from your cash deposits available to you immediately and make funds from your check deposits available to you within two business days after we receive your deposit. Electronic direct deposits will be available on the day we receive the deposit. Once they are available, you can withdraw the funds in cash and we will use the funds to pay checks that you have written. For determining the availability of your deposits, every day is a business day, except Saturdays, Sundays, and federal holidays. We have different deposit cut-off hours for different deposit locations. The earliest cut-off time that might apply is 4:00 p.m. If you make a deposit before our cut-off hour on a business day that we are open, we will consider that day to be the day of your deposit. However, if you make a deposit after our cut-off hour or on a day we are not open, we will consider that the deposit was made on the next business day we are open. Our cut-off hours are available at the credit union. Reservation of Right to Hold In some cases, we will not make all of the funds that you deposit by check available to you on the second business day after we receive your deposit. The first $225.00 of your deposit will be available on the first business day after the day of your deposit. We will notify you at the time you make your deposit of any holds. We will also tell you when the funds will be available. If your deposit is not made directly to one of our employees, or if we decide to take this action after you have left the premises, we will mail you the notice by the next business day after we receive your deposit. If you will need the funds from a deposit right away, you should ask us when the funds will be available.
